Why the birth certificate matters
The birth certificate is the first and most important identity document a person gets. In Tamil Nadu it's needed for school admission, passport, Aadhaar, age proof for exams and jobs, and many welfare schemes. Registering the birth promptly and keeping the certificate safe saves a lot of trouble later — proving age without it can become a slow, paperwork-heavy process.
The 21-day rule
Under the law, a birth should be registered within 21 days of the date of birth, and registration within this window is free. Miss it, and:
| When registered | What's needed |
|---|---|
| Within 21 days | Normal registration, free |
| After 21 days (up to a limit) | Late fee, may need extra verification |
| After a long delay | Order from the competent authority / affidavit |
Hospital births are usually reported by the hospital, but parents should confirm the name, date and details were correctly submitted — small spelling errors cause big headaches at passport and school stages.
Where a birth is registered
Registration is done with the local body where the birth took place — the Greater Chennai Corporation, another municipal corporation, a municipality, or a town panchayat — or through a Common Service Centre. The registrar records the event and issues the certificate.
How to download a birth certificate online
- Go to the CRS-TN portal at crstn.org and open the birth-certificate search.
- Search using the registration number, or the child's name, date of birth and parents' names.
- Locate the record (available online for births from 1 January 2018).
- View and download the certificate; a certified copy may carry a small fee.
Chennai residents can also use the Greater Chennai Corporation online birth-and-death service for city births.
Documents for registration and correction
- Hospital birth report or proof of birth
- Parents' identity and address proof (Aadhaar)
- Parents' marriage details where required
- For name inclusion/correction later, supporting documents and an application to the registrar
Common issues
- Name not added — for hospital births the name is sometimes added later; apply for name inclusion.
- Spelling / date errors — apply to the registrar with proof to correct them.
- Pre-2018 births — not online; visit the local-body office that registered it.
Adding or correcting the name
A very common situation: the birth was registered from the hospital before the baby was named, so the certificate shows "(baby of ...)" with no name. You can apply for name inclusion at the registrar/local body with the required form and proof, and the name is added to the record. Similarly, if there's a spelling mistake or wrong date, you apply for a correction with supporting documents (such as the hospital record). Fix these early — a mismatch between the birth certificate and Aadhaar or school records causes real delays at passport and admission stages years later.
How long it takes and what it costs
| Step | Typical position |
|---|---|
| Registration within 21 days | Free; certificate issued shortly after |
| Online download (2018 onward) | Instant search; small fee for a certified copy |
| Late registration | Late fee + verification; longer for old delays |
| Name inclusion / correction | Application to the registrar with proof |
Because the first certificate on timely registration is essentially free and the process is quick, the smart move is simply to register on time and download a copy right away — then keep it safe with the family's important papers.
